I've been reading this forum and every tip I can find but am drawing a blank. I have the thumbnails on the page and they open the large version just fine but the problem is ALL of the thumbnails (40 or 50 of them) are displaying whereas I would like only 6 or 7 to show in a scrollable (sideways) window.

Could someone please point me in the right direction for instructions on how to do this? I know it's possible; just can't figure out how. Thanks so much!

Perhaps you have the floatbox class on the body element or some containing div so Floatbox is picking up all the images on the page???

If so, and you want only some of the image links to display in floatbox, put the floatbox class only on the ones that you want. Group the links into a gallery set by assigning a common 'group' setting to them.

As for a sideways scrollable window, I'm sorry but I don't know what you have in mind here.
